Post by: mikesaa309 on Thursday, 26 April 2018, 12:11 AM
Given the bike a quick hose down, couldn't be bothered to get pressure washer out especially as it's meant to be raining later on but anyways went out for a shortish ride parked up at a near by ww2 memorial and took some more pics of it and have added it to the photos.

Looks wise it's growing on me slowly, comfort wise I still need to do a really long ride but does seem quite comfy tho not sure if it's anymore or less comfy than stock. Will say though that it's heavier than stock having a metal base rather than plastic and so it's a bit more cumbersome to take off if I want to put anything under the seat. I took my brother out on it for the first time with the new seat and he found it more comfy than stock and ironically is able to hold onto the grab rail better as I'm a big lad and the seat means I have to sit further forward and so he gets more room. Have also found because of the riding position being higher up and further forward it puts more strain on my wrists but not entirely sure. Still undecided but it's slowly growing on me but still not sure lol.
